Mobile web: the game changed http://econsultancy.com/us/blog/7468-mobile-web-the-game-changed Game changed for email? Email has gone mobile. According to the Econsultancy Mobile Statistics Compendium, email is used by 75.4% of British iPhone owners, making it the most popular internet activity on the phone. When exceptional growth is not an exception | asymco http://www.asymco.com/2011/04/29/when-exceptional-growth-is-not-an-exception/ Apple’s last quarter’s sales growth was an impressive 83%. It was not as high as the 92% earnings rise because there was a higher mix of iPhones this quarter than in the past. The iPhone is the most profitable product in Apple’s portfolio [...]
